Demonstration of therapeutic potency is critical for successful development and commercialization of viral-vector based products. In fact, the potency assay is one of the most critical cornerstone assays for successful clinical programs.
However, depending on the intended indication, in vivo-based potency assays may be difficult to design and implement successfully. In these instances, a total potency assurance strategy may be used to infer potency indirectly. This webinar explores how next-generation sequencing can support potency assurance using adeno-associated virus as a model.
Total potency assurance assays focus on the Critical Quality Attributes (CQA’s) for the specific type of molecule being assessed and combine multiple assays which serve different functions. For example, a total potency assurance package may include assays for particle assessment, nucleic acid assessment, functional titer and many other applications.
